Transaction

a77683dbb92fb617a5b90e2ba82ae56a50d9b20fcf203389a632f4a8db76d8ad

Summary

In Block65788
TimeMon, 20 Feb 2023 03:18:45 UTC
Total Input2045.22839617 Nebula
Total Output2045.22833257 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
889445 Confirmations2045.22833257 Nebula
Raw Transaction